abstract | The present invention provides a method of manufacturing a glassnsheet with a thin film. In the method, a coating-film forming gas including anchlorine-containing compound is supplied onto a glass containing an alkalincomponent to generate chloride fine particles containing the alkali componentnwhile forming a thin film to allow the chloride fine particles to be included innthe thin film or to adhere to the surface thereof, and thereby the surface ofnthe thin film is provided with concavities and convexities. The presentninvention also provides another method of manufacturing a glass sheet with anthin film. In the another method, a coating-film forming gas including ansilicon-containing inorganic compound and an organic gas is supplied ontonglass to generate silicon-containing fine particles while forming ansilicon-containing film and thereby the silicon-containing fine particles arenallowed to adhere to the surface of the silicon-containing film. |
